Scar Laser
Removal

Scar Laser Removal at Evolution Aesthetics uses the Alma Harmony XL PRO iPixel fractional laser to smooth acne, surgical, and injury scars. The laser creates tiny micro-columns in the skin that trigger collagen repair while keeping surrounding skin intact, so recovery is typically quick. In selected cases, we also use NIR (Near Infrared) on the same Harmony XL PRO device to soften edges and improve firmness around the scar. Each plan is tailored to scar type, skin tone, and treatment area for balanced, natural-looking results. Most people see gradual improvement over several weeks as texture becomes more even. Fractional precision that remodels collagen, not just the surface
We use the Alma Harmony XL PRO with the iPixel fractional handpiece to deliver controlled, microscopic columns of 2940 nm Er:YAG energy into the skin. These microthermal channels break down tight, disordered collagen inside the scar while leaving bridges of intact tissue around each spot. The intact skin speeds re‑epithelialization, and the focused thermal injury triggers a wound‑healing cascade: fibroblasts produce new, better‑aligned collagen and elastin, the scar softens, and texture evens out. The iPixel scanner creates a uniform pattern (a small matrix of pixel beams) for predictable coverage and depth. For selected cases, we add NIR (Near Infrared) on the Harmony XL PRO—broadband infrared gently warms the dermis to approximately 40–42°C, which promotes collagen contraction and neocollagenesis, helping blend the scar edges and improve firmness. Settings such as energy, density, and passes are adjusted to scar type (atrophic, hypertrophic, post‑surgical), location, and skin tone; we may perform test spots and use topical anesthetic before treatment.Contraindications
Laser treatments are not suitable for everyone. We assess your medical history, medications, and skin condition to minimize risks and plan the safest approach for your skin.
- Active skin infection, inflammation, or acne flare in the treatment area
- Active herpes simplex (cold sores) on or near the area
- Recent isotretinoin use (within the last 6–12 months)
- History of keloids or hypertrophic scarring (requires careful assessment)
- Uncontrolled diabetes or impaired wound healing
- Pregnancy or breastfeeding
- Recent sunburn, tanning, or self‑tanner on the area (last 2–4 weeks)
- Photosensitizing medications (e.g., doxycycline) within the last 2 weeks
- Seizure disorders triggered by light
- Open wounds, eczema, or dermatitis on the treatment site
Clear plan, predictable recovery, lasting change
Most patients need 3–5 iPixel sessions spaced 4–6 weeks apart to see a significant difference in scar depth and texture; deep or long‑standing scars may require 5–6 sessions. NIR, when used as an adjunct, is typically scheduled as 3–6 sessions every 1–2 weeks to soften edges and boost firmness. A typical appointment takes 20–45 minutes depending on the area, plus 20–30 minutes for topical numbing. Expect redness and mild heat for several hours, then bronzing or a faint grid with micro‑crusting for 3–7 days (face tends to heal faster than body). Visible changes start in 2–4 weeks and continue to build for 3–6 months as collagen remodels; improvements are long‑lasting because scar structure is reorganized. Pre‑care: avoid tanning and sunburn for 2 weeks, pause retinoids and exfoliating acids for 5–7 days, avoid photosensitizing drugs when possible, and tell us about any history of cold sores. Aftercare: cool compresses as needed on day one, gentle cleanser and bland moisturizer, no picking or scrubbing, avoid hot tubs/saunas/gym for 48 hours, high‑SPF broad‑spectrum sunscreen daily, and pause retinoids/acids for 5–7 days. Makeup can usually be worn after 24 hours if skin is intact.
